Understanding the Composition of Pet Gloves Wipes
To determine whether pet gloves wipes are waterproof, we first need to understand their composition. These wipes are typically made from a blend of materials designed to be soft on a pet's skin while still being durable enough to perform their cleaning function. The outer layer is often a non - woven fabric that can hold the cleaning solution. This fabric is engineered to be porous enough to release the cleaning agents onto the pet's fur and skin but also sturdy enough to withstand the friction of cleaning.
The cleaning solution itself is a crucial component. It usually contains a mixture of mild detergents, moisturizers, and sometimes antibacterial agents. The detergents help to break down dirt, oil, and debris on the pet's coat, while the moisturizers prevent the skin from drying out. Some wipes may also have fragrances to leave the pet smelling fresh.


Testing for Waterproofness
To assess the waterproofness of pet gloves wipes, we can conduct a series of simple tests. One common method is the water droplet test. When a water droplet is placed on the surface of the wipe, if it beads up and does not immediately soak into the material, it indicates a certain level of water - resistance. However, this does not necessarily mean the wipe is completely waterproof.
Another test is the immersion test. We can submerge a pet gloves wipe in water for a set period, say 5 minutes. After removal, if the wipe retains its structural integrity and the cleaning solution inside does not leak out excessively, it shows that the wipe has some degree of waterproofness.
In our experience as a supplier, most high - quality pet gloves wipes are designed to be water - resistant rather than fully waterproof. This is because they need to be able to release the cleaning solution onto the pet's fur when in contact. A fully waterproof wipe would not be able to effectively transfer the cleaning agents, rendering it less useful for its intended purpose.
Benefits of Water - Resistant Pet Gloves Wipes
The water - resistant property of pet gloves wipes offers several benefits. Firstly, it allows the wipes to be used in a variety of cleaning situations. For example, if your pet has gotten dirty in a wet environment, such as after a walk in the rain, the water - resistant wipe can still effectively clean the fur without getting soggy and falling apart.
Secondly, it helps to preserve the cleaning solution inside the wipe. Since the wipe can resist water penetration to some extent, the cleaning agents remain intact and active for a longer period. This ensures that each use of the wipe provides the same level of cleaning performance.
Limitations of Water - Resistance
However, it is important to note the limitations of water - resistant pet gloves wipes. They are not suitable for long - term submersion in water. If you try to use them in a high - moisture environment for an extended period, the water may eventually seep through the material, diluting the cleaning solution and reducing its effectiveness.
Also, the water - resistant property may vary depending on the quality of the wipe. Cheaper or lower - quality wipes may have a weaker water - resistant barrier, which means they may not hold up as well in wet conditions.
